Runbook: Scanline barcode bridge

If warehouse scans stop flowing into Cartwheel, it's almost always the bridge service on the Dunmore floor box wedging after a USB hiccup. Bounce the service first — nine times out of ten that fixes it. If not, check the queue depth before escalating. When restarting, make sure the bridge comes up with these settings.

deployment values, yafop-bajef:
[gilok]
team = ulaius
access_code = ac_423664
host = gilok.sivrelhq.corp
port = 9200
owner = pelius.istax
peer = eliok.torvasoft.internal

Before promoting the PickPath Optimizer build to the Larkvale fulfillment cluster, verify that the artifact hash matches the record in the Ledgerline manifest and that the staging soak completed without anomaly flags. All deploys to Larkvale require dual approval from the release captain and the on-call warehouse systems engineer. The optimizer binary must be signed prior to upload; unsigned artifacts are rejected by the ingest gate. For audit traceability, the signing key used for this release is recorded below.

release key, hagug-yaguf: bky13_NnhXrmFGhCRtW

Handover Note — Support Outsourcing Plan

Hi Dara — picking up where I left off: the outsourcing of tier-one support to Quenlow Partners is at the contract-draft stage. Vendor scoring is done, Fennick's team ran the pilot, and results were decent. Heads of department have the transition timeline already. One thing stays between us for now, noted confidentially below.

confidential, kagup-bafog: Fraaxax Group is in early talks to buy Soroxox Group for about $343.8 million. The Olidor launch date is June 14, and nothing goes to the press before then. Legal wants the Aldmirek Logistics term sheet signed before July 23.